Job Description
Work on the cutting edge of threat intelligence – be among the first to identify, assess, and understand financially motivated cyber criminal groups and campaigns that matter. Mandiant is seeking a technical cyber crime analyst to join the Financial Crime Analysis team, which identifies, tracks, and reports on threat actors who impact organizations across the globe. This work supports both corporate and government intelligence clients as well as other divisions of Mandiant. The Technical Analyst will play a key role on our team, leading the investigation and analysis into these operations. An emphasis will be placed on the identification of novel and impactful malware campaigns and intrusion activity. The successful candidate is a seasoned analyst capable of interpreting vast quantities of data from various sources and communicating those findings to both internal and external stakeholders. We encourage giving back to the community and strongly support sharing of expertise by authoring white-papers and speaking at conferences.
What You Will Do:
- Identify, assess, and track the tactics, techniques, and procedures of financially motivated threat actors using the unique data produced across all of Mandiant and via your own independent research
- Perform technical analysis on malicious artifacts, attacker infrastructure, and forensic data sourced from organizations impacted by some of the world’s most capable cyber criminals
- Stay current on new malware and TTPs employed by threat actors
- Support the creation of written analytic products, which include assessments derived from Mandiant’s proprietary datasets and the analyst’s independent research, for internal and external stakeholders
- Work independently and collaborate with individuals throughout the Mandiant organization to develop and coordinate the delivery of threat insights
Qualifications
Required Experience and Skills:
- 4+ years experience working with malware or exploits, or engaged in threat research, incident handling, or another adjacent area of practice
- Understanding of cyber crime threats and the supporting ecosystem
- Understanding of common tools and tactics used by threat actors throughout the intrusion lifecycle
- Experience with a variety of technical analysis tasks, including:
- Analyzing malicious files: binaries, scripts, and documents
- Reviewing network packet captures
- Reviewing application and operating system event logs
- Comfortable with one or more scripting language
- Ability to write Yara and Snort signatures for the purpose of identifying and classifying malware
- Ability to communicate complex technical concepts to non-technical people
Desirable Experience and Skills:
- Possesses deep subject matter expertise on several different cyber crime malware families and/or threat actors, including how they have evolved over time
- Practical experience as an intelligence analyst
- Ability to identify and communicate effective strategies to mitigate tools and techniques used by threat actors throughout the attack lifecycle.
- Strong grasp of analytical techniques used to support attribution assessments
- Familiarity with common threat intelligence platforms and tools
- Experience documenting research findings in graph-based database schema
- History of participation in industry or technology information sharing groups, formal or informal
- Understanding of monetization and fraud strategies employed by cyber threat actors
- Foreign language skills in Russian, Chinese, Arabic, Farsi, and/or other major European languages
